They may be putting the efforts and hard work on the cricket field but they are humans and have a social life too, yes here we are talking about cricketers. After the long day and hectic practice sessions they too love to go out for a movie or a social hang out with close friends and families.
Punjab cricketer Yuvraj Singh recently took his teammates including Harmeet Singh, Manan Vohra, Sid Kaul, Ladda Sarbjeet and Gurkeerat Mann for a movie. After movie the whole bunch of friends posed for a picture where they were seen showing their fists.
An ecstatic Harmeet took it to his Instagram handle and posted a picture along with captions which reads, “#thanks @groovi12 paji for the #movie #creed !! Had #awesome #timewith all these #clowns @gurkeeratmann @sranbarinder51 @iamladda10 @siddikaul @mandeeps12 @mananvohra54”

Punjab is sitting at the apex of the Group A points table in the Vijay Hazare Trophy at the moment and have their next encounter against Services on Friday. Last year, they ended as the runners-up. When the ambience in the dressing room is cool and calm the team automatically performs well and somewhat similar is happening with Punjab team at the moment.
